A CARVED BAMBOO BRUSHPOT MING DYNASTY |

Description

  • 13.5 cm, 5 1/4  in.
of oval section with undulating tapering sides, deeply carved to the onr side with three scholars and an attendant standing in a rocky clearing, the wood patinated to a rich dark tone

Condition

This brushpot is in overall good condition, with the exception of some shallow cracks to the rim and foot, as well as some minor expected surface wear. There is a small area of infill to the exterior from the rim extending to the body, measuring approx. 3.7 cm long.
